Online Communications, Games

When you play any of the games offered and/or served by NCI, or use any of the communication features on the Sites, your IP address (the Internet protocol address from which you access any of the above) may be stored in our records.

When any game is updated or "patched," our patch routine may check your computer to see that you have the most recent version of game-specific files; when you communicate within any game or any other communication feature within any of our Sites (e.g. live chat, instant message services and the like), even "privately" to another person, you do so with the understanding that those communications go through our servers, can be monitored by us, you have no expectation of privacy in any of those communications and, accordingly, you expressly consent to monitoring of communications (including technical support and customer service communications) that you send and receive.

When you log into one of our online games, your system specifications (such as OS, RAM, video card, monitor, system configuration, etc.) may be reviewed/recorded by us for the purposes of analyzing and optimizing your game experience and in order to provide you with customer service.

In-Game Advertising

Our games may incorporate dynamic advertisement serving technology offered by Double Fusion ("Ad Providers"), which enables advertising to be temporarily uploaded into the game on your PC or console, and replaced while you play online.

Ad Providers only log information that is needed to measure presentation of, and serve advertising to the appropriate geographic region, and to the right location within the game. Logged data may include Internet Protocol Address or player's user name, in game location, length of time an advertisement was visible, size of the advertisements, and angle of view.

Your game may be assigned an id number, which is stored on your PC or console, and used by Ad Providers to calculate the number of unique and repeat views of dynamic in game advertising. The id number is not associated with any personal data. No logged information is used to personally identify you. The servers used by the Ad Providers may be located outside your country of residence. If you reside in a Member State of the European Union, the servers may be located outside of the European Union.

This ad serving technology is integrated into the game; if you do not want to use this technology, do not play the game while connected to the Internet. For more information concerning Double Fusion, please visit their website.
